什么是vmess和ss?
在现代网络中,隐私和安全性已经变得尤为重要。为了保护用户的网络活动,出现了多种代理协议,其中最为常见的包括vmess和ss(Shadowsocks)。
- vmess 是 V2Ray 项目中的一种代理协议,它通过加密和多路复用技术提供了较高的安全性和灵活性。
- ss(Shadowsocks) 是一种简单而高效的代理工具,通常用于绕过网络封锁。
vmess和ss的基本概念
1. vmess协议
- 定义:vmess是一种用于代理连接的协议,属于V2Ray项目的一部分。
- 特性:支持多种加密方式、传输层协议和路由功能,提供了更强的灵活性。
2. ss协议
- 定义:ss是一种轻量级的代理工具,基于 SOCKS5 协议实现。
- 特性:容易配置和使用,适合普通用户和开发者。
vmess与ss的主要区别
1. 加密方式
- vmess:使用多种加密方式,如AES-128-GCM、ChaCha20等,提供更加强大的安全性。
- ss:使用单一加密方式,如AES-256-CFB,虽然安全性较高但不如vmess的选项多。
2. 传输效率
- vmess:由于其多路复用的特性,可以在同一连接上处理多个请求,从而提高了传输效率。
- ss:相对较简单,适合小规模使用,但在流量较大时可能会出现瓶颈。
3. 使用场景
- vmess:适合于需要高度安全和灵活性的环境,如企业以及需要高度隐私保护的用户。
- ss:适合轻量级的需求,如家庭网络使用和开发测试。
4. 配置难度
- vmess:配置相对复杂,需要用户具备一定的技术知识,特别是在服务器端的设置上。
- ss:相对简单,用户友好的配置界面使得新手也能快速上手。
vmess和ss的优缺点
vmess的优点
- 提供多种加密方式,增强安全性。
- 支持多路复用,提升数据传输效率。
- 具有强大的路由功能。
vmess的缺点
- 配置复杂,门槛较高。
- 可能需要额外的硬件支持。
ss的优点
- 简单易用,适合新手。
- 较低的资源占用。
ss的缺点
- 安全性相对较低。
- 不支持多路复用,流量大时存在瓶颈。
选择vmess还是ss?
在选择vmess还是ss时,需要根据自身的需求:
- 如果你追求安全性、稳定性和灵活性,建议选择vmess。
- 如果你的需求相对简单,并且希望快速配置,ss是一个不错的选择。
FAQ(常见问题解答)
1. vmess和ss哪个更安全?
一般来说,vmess相对于ss更安全,因为它支持多种加密方式,并且可以灵活配置传输层协议,提供更高的安全保障。
2. vmess和ss适合什么用户?
- vmess适合企业用户、高需求用户和注重隐私保护的人;
- ss适合普通家庭用户和开发者。
3. vmess和ss的配置过程是怎样的?
- vmess的配置通常需要用户在服务器和客户端上分别进行设置,可能涉及到服务器的搭建和配置文件的修改;
- ss的配置较为简单,用户只需下载客户端,然后填写服务器信息即可。
4. 使用vmess和ss需要支付费用吗?
通常,使用这两种协议都需要有一个支持的服务器,而服务器的费用一般是需要支付的,具体费用取决于服务器的提供商。
5. 服务稳定性如何?
vmess由于其技术架构,通常在复杂的网络环境下表现得更加稳定,而ss在轻松网络条件下也能保持良好的稳定性,但是在高流量情况下可能会有所下降。
结论
总的来说,vmess和ss各有优势和局限。用户根据自己的需求与使用环境,可以选择合适的协议,以确保网络的安全与畅通。
正文完